Frequently Asked Questions
DogWatch SmartFence®
What is a DogWatch SmartFence®?
The DogWatch SmartFence® is a hidden underground pet fencing system that uses a low-level radio signal to safely keep your dog within a designated area, like your yard, or away from areas such as gardens, patios, or pools.
Unique to DogWatch, the SmartFence communicates with you by text or email alerts if there’s a wire break, a low collar battery, or boundary testing, giving you complete peace of mind.
How does the DogWatch SmartFence® work?
A boundary wire is buried a few inches underground around your property. The transmitter inside your home sends a radio signal through that wire. Your pet wears a SmartCollar® that recognizes the signal, emitting an audible or vibration warning when the dog nears the boundary and a mild, safe correction if it proceeds further.
The SmartFence Portal, connected via your home Internet, sends real-time alerts and tracks activity through the SmartFence App on iPhone or Android.
Do I need Internet or a smartphone?
The fence works without Internet, but communication alerts and activity tracking require an Internet connection.
You can still access your account from any web-enabled computer even if you don’t use a smartphone.
What happens if my Internet stops working?
The containment system continues functioning normally. Only the alert and activity-tracking features pause until Internet service resumes.
What if my dog leaves Wi-Fi or communication range?
Your dog’s SmartCollar® will still operate safely, it’s normal for pets to explore areas beyond the portal’s range.
What if my router lacks an extra Ethernet port?
An inexpensive Ethernet switch (available at major retailers) can add ports to your router for SmartFence connectivity.
Hidden Dog Fences
What is a hidden fence?
A hidden fence, sometimes called an “invisible fence”, uses a buried wire that transmits a harmless signal to your dog’s receiver collar. It can protect outdoor areas or create indoor boundaries that keep pets off furniture or out of specific rooms.
How do hidden fences work?
When your pet nears the boundary, the collar gives a warning beep or vibration. If your pet continues, it receives a mild static correction. With training and visual flags, pets quickly learn their safe zones.

SkyShepherd GPS Dog Fence
What is SkyShepherd?
SkyShepherd is DogWatch’s revolutionary GPS-based containment collar. Using a GPS receiver and smart processor, it lets you set custom boundaries in seconds through the SkyShepherd mobile app, ideal for large Florida properties.
Is the feedback safe?
Yes. The stimuli are gentle and optimized for a dog’s physiology, effective yet harmless.
Where does SkyShepherd work best?
Ideal for properties of one acre or more with open yard space. It’s not suited for water boundaries or densely wooded canopies.
How does my dog learn a GPS fence boundary?
SkyShepherd’s patented Shepherding® technology guides your dog using adaptive feedback and positive reinforcement to help it recognize safe zones.

Training & Remote Collars
What is a remote trainer?
A DogWatch BigLeash® remote trainer helps reinforce commands and correct unwanted behaviors using audible tones, vibration, or low-level stimulation, great for off-leash training.

At what age can I begin remote training?
Typically around 5-6 months, once your dog understands basic commands. We will evaluate readiness.
What safety features does BigLeash have?
Fifteen adjustable levels, tone/vibration modes, and an automatic 8-second shut-off prevent over-correction.
No-Bark Collars
What is the BarkCollar used for?
It reduces or eliminates excessive barking through sound, vibration, or mild static feedback.
How long does training take?
Most dogs adjust within a few days to weeks depending on personality and triggers.
At what age and size can my dog use it?
Recommended for dogs 4-6 months old and 4 lbs or heavier.
